As nouns, current of air is a hypernym of boreas; that is, current of air is a word with a broader meaning than boreas:
  • boreas: a wind that blows from the north
  • current of air: air moving (sometimes with considerable force) from an area of high pressure to an area of low pressure
Other hypernyms of boreas include air current, wind.
